WebGulf water temperature is 85ºF, and the Tampa Bay water temperature is 88ºF. When the water temps soar, the oxygen content drops. So, trying to keep a caught fish alive, on a stringer, in that kind of heat, with diminished oxygen supply, simply won't work. The fish will soon die, and at that point begins to decay. Just say 'NO' to stringers. Web21 mrt. 2014 · We use a rope stringer about 15 foot long that has moving clips that slide along the rope, also each clip has a large ball bearing swivel on it. This way each fish can move the way he wants, and no fish is upside down. We also might tie another rope on the long stronger to get it deeper. When still fishing I put the stringer through both lips. sackville rotary club
